At 35,000 miles the engine quit. I could smell wires burning. The box that holds the fuses melted with no blown fuses. They replaced the box. After 12,000 mores miles the engine quit on the highway and the fuse box caught fire this time. I raised the hood and saw sparks jumping around and a flame in the box with a lot of smoke. I quickly disconnected the battery and put out the fire.

Positioning of the vehicle battery and battery tray permits leaking battery acid to drip down onto the cruise control servo, vacuum lines, and electrical wires.
